Our review of the Skechers Men's Go Walk Max - Effort Walking Shoes finds them best suited for daily walkers and anyone who prioritizes cushioned comfort over aggressive support. These shoes deliver an immediately noticeable, soft ride thanks to the Goga Max high-rebound comfort insole and the lightweight 5GEN midsole, making them ideal for long errands, travel, or light gym sessions. The nearly seamless breathable air-mesh upper keeps feet cool while reducing chafing, so the biggest reason to buy is consistent, easygoing comfort combined with low maintenance machine-washable convenience.
Key Features
- Breathable upper: The nearly seamless air-mesh upper improves ventilation and reduces rubbing for cooler, more comfortable walks.
- 5GEN cushioning: The lightweight, responsive midsole and outsole provide a springy, cushioned feel that absorbs everyday impact.
- Goga Max insole: The high-rebound comfort insole gives noticeable heel and forefoot padding for prolonged standing or walking.
- Flexible outsole: The rubber outsole bends easily to match natural foot motion and supports a smooth stride.
- Machine washable: The upper and insole tolerate machine washing and air drying, which simplifies upkeep after heavy use.
Who It's For
The Go Walk Max - Effort is aimed at men who want a low-effort, comfortable walking shoe for daily use, travel, or jobs that require a lot of standing. Its lightweight construction and plush insole suit people who prefer a soft, cushioned feel rather than a firm, corrective support shoe.
Those needing rigid stability, motion control, or heavy-duty trail performance should look elsewhere; the shoe shines on pavement, in casual athletic settings, and around town but is not designed as a hiking or specialized running shoe.

Frequently Asked Questions
Are these shoes good for long walks?
Yes, the 5GEN cushioning and Goga Max insole provide comfortable, responsive support for extended walking on pavement and flat surfaces.
Can I wash these in a machine?
Yes, the shoes are machine washable; allow them to air dry rather than using a dryer to preserve materials and shape.
Do they run true to size?
Most customers report a reliable fit; the breathable mesh upper also offers slight give for comfort during wear.
